Core Technologies Behind Fair Automatic Systems

Random Number Generators (RNGs)

RNGs are the backbone of fair game outcomes. Modern RNGs are designed to produce sequences that are statistically random, with no predictable patterns. They are often certified by independent auditors to ensure they meet industry standards. For example, in many online slot games, RNGs determine symbol placements, ensuring each spin is independent and unbiased.

Return to Player (RTP) Metrics

RTP indicates the percentage of wagered money a game is designed to return to players over time. A typical online slot might have an RTP of 97%, meaning that, on average, players can expect to get back 97 units for every 100 wagered. This metric helps regulators and players assess whether a game adheres to fairness standards. Transparent reporting of RTP fosters trust and accountability.

How Automated Fairness Counters Potential Biases

Detecting and Mitigating Patterns or Manipulations

Automated systems continuously monitor game data to identify unusual patterns that could indicate manipulation or cheating. For example, if a player consistently lands on winning combinations beyond statistical expectations, algorithms flag this for review. Such proactive detection ensures that games remain fair and transparent, deterring malicious behavior.

Ensuring Unbiased Random Events

The randomness of outcomes, such as landing on a winning ship, is maintained through certified RNGs that are regularly audited. These audits confirm that no external influence can bias results, preserving fairness over millions of game rounds. Such rigorous oversight is vital for industry credibility and player confidence.

Legal and Regulatory Considerations

Automated fairness systems must comply with regional laws and industry standards. Certification by independent auditors, transparent reporting, and adherence to RTP benchmarks are essential. For example, jurisdictions like the UK and Malta require rigorous testing and reporting, which automated systems facilitate efficiently.
